Faith

Without faith there is no knowledge, without knowledge there is no virtuous conduct, without virtues there is no deliverance, and without deliverance there is no perfection.
- Scriptures

Generally the theories we believe we call facts, and the facts we disbelieve we call theories.
- Felix S. Cohen

The faith of every man, O Arjuna, accords with his nature, Man is made up of faith; as is his faith, so is he. The threefold austerity practiced with faith by men of balanced mind, without any expectation of reward, is said to be pure.
- Srimad Bhagavad Gita

The smallest seed of faith is better than the largest fruit of happiness.
- Henry David Thoreau

Faith never makes a confession.
- Henry David Thoreau

Every man prefers belief to the exercise of judgment.
- Seneca the Younger

The eloquent man is he who is no beautiful speaker, but who is inwardly and desperately drunk with a certain belief.
- Ralph Waldo Emerson

Believe you can and you're halfway there.
- Theodore Roosevelt

What matters is not the idea a man holds, but the depth at which he holds it.
- Ezra Pound

For those who believe, no proof is necessary. For those who don't believe, no proof is possible.
- Stuart Chase
